Solution for 15x-4=7x+2 equation:


Simplifying
15x + -4 = 7x + 2

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 15x = 7x + 2

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 15x = 2 + 7x

Solving
-4 + 15x = 2 + 7x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7x'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 15x + -7x = 2 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 15x + -7x = 8x
-4 + 8x = 2 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 7x + -7x = 0
-4 + 8x = 2 + 0
-4 + 8x = 2

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 4 + 8x = 2 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+ 8x = 2 + 4
8x = 2 + 4

Combine like terms: 2 + 4 = 6
8x = 6

Divide each side by '8'.
x = 0.75

Simplifying
x = 0.75
